(WJAR) — The Providence City Council will hold a vote on May 15 at 6 p.m. on overriding Mayor Brett Smiley's veto of the council's rent stabilization ordinance, according to City Council President Rachel Miller. The ordinance would cap annual rent increases at 4% annually, while leaving exemptions for property owners to address certain costs.
